What is a merchant cash advance?

A merchant cash advance (MCA) provides businesses with a lump sum of capital in exchange for a percentage of future sales. This is not a traditional loan. It's a flexible funding solution designed for businesses needing quick access to cash.

Is merchant cash advance illegal?

No, merchant cash advances are legal. They are a legitimate financial tool for businesses. MCA providers operate within legal frameworks, offering a service distinct from traditional lending institutions.

What happens if I can't pay back a merchant cash advance?

If repayment becomes difficult, communicate immediately with the MCA provider. They may offer restructuring options. Failure to communicate can lead to more serious collection efforts, impacting your business's financial health.

What is MCA in loans?

MCA refers to Merchant Cash Advance. It's a type of financing where a business receives a cash payment for a portion of its future credit and debit card sales. It's a faster, often more accessible alternative to conventional business loans.

Are MCA loans worth it?

MCA loans can be worth it for businesses needing rapid capital for growth or to manage cash flow gaps. The cost is often higher than traditional loans, but the speed and accessibility can justify it for specific situations in Columbia.
